Marry them!

Half a million old girls is too much, too. Kazakhstan has about 500,000 single women: no question of leaving them on the floor. If elected president in April, the candidate Amanta Kajy plans to create a council of elders - the Aksakal - who choose husbands for the girls, aged 25-45 years. Unions will be at taxpayer expense, said Kazah Express-K.
